Why receiving roles are critical in warehouse operations
Unlike roles focused on outbound shipments, receiving positions deal with incoming inventory that must be accounted for before it moves further into the system. This means your work directly impacts inventory accuracy and order fulfillment. Compared to roles like Package Handler or Sortation Associate, this job involves more verification and attention to detail rather than just movement of goods. It’s a role where precision matters as much as speed.
What happens during a typical shift
Your shift usually begins with reviewing scheduled deliveries and preparing the receiving area. As shipments arrive, you’ll unload goods, check them against documentation, and scan items into the system. Once verified, products are labeled and moved to their designated storage locations. The process is organized and supported by scanning tools, but it requires consistent focus to ensure accuracy.

What does a warehouse worker do?
Ensuring cleanliness, tidiness and safety of work environment. Loading and unloading delivery vehicles. Accepting delivery of inventory. Counting and confirming inventory. Inspecting inventory for damage and faults.
What is the duty of warehouse staff?
A Warehouse Worker is responsible for varied daily tasks such as restocking shelves, accepting incoming orders, processing and packing orders, counting inventory and ensuring orders are shipped in a timely manner.
